Search for the X(1812) in $B^{\pm} \to K^{\pm} \omega \phi$

This study searches for the X(1812) particle in B meson decays but finds no significant evidence, setting upper limits on its production rate and the overall decay process.
Contribution
First search for X(1812) in B decays with a large data sample, establishing upper limits on its branching fractions.
Findings
No significant X(1812) signal observed.
Upper limit on B decay involving X(1812) set at 3.2×10^{-7}.
Overall B decay to ωφ constrained to less than 1.9×10^{-6}.
